Manga artist Akima confirmed on their Twitter account that the Shojo Null manga, written by Nakanishi Kanae and illustrated by Akima, will end in four chapters. The news was confirmed on August 9th, 2024, along with the release of chapter 29.

Nakanishi (Hiasobi Domei!) and Akima started the series in August 2023 on Shueisha’s Shounen Jump+ platform, and Shueisha published the manga’s first tankoubon volume in December 2023 and the second volume in April 2024. The manga’s third volume is set to be released on September 4th, 2024. The manga is also published in English on the MANGA Plus website.
With the proliferation of organic robots called Gijins, humanity is enjoying prosperity in 23rd-century Tokyo. But when a young man named Riaha meets a certain Gijin, he uncovers the dark truth of the world!
